a living doll

1. A strikingly beautiful infant or young child, especially a girl. Have you seen Mike and Jennifer's baby girl? Oh my gosh, she's a living doll! You should really think about getting your daughter into commercials because she is just a living doll! Look at how cute your mom was as a baby. Truly, a living doll!
2. Someone who is especially considerate, attentive, and amiable. A: "I can't believe Maureen dropped off freshly baked cookies for us!" B: "I know, she is just a living doll." Thank you so much for giving us a place to stay. You're a living doll. A: "Oh, and I got your 8 AM meeting pushed to 11 tomorrow." B: "You're a living doll, Kristine! Thank you, I definitely need that extra time to prepare."

living doll, a

An extremely nice person, amiable and generous. Why a child’s toy should be chosen for this metaphor is not known. Doll alone has meant a young and attractive woman since the mid-1800s, as in Frank Loesser’s hit musical comedy Guys and Dolls (1950). However, the current usage, dating from the 1940s, is applied to individuals of either sex and any age.
